About

Hongxiao Liu is a scholar working on Global and Planetary Change, Health, Toxicology and Mutagenesis and Molecular Biology. According to data from OpenAlex, Hongxiao Liu has authored 59 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Global and Planetary Change, 12 papers in Health, Toxicology and Mutagenesis and 9 papers in Molecular Biology. Recurrent topics in Hongxiao Liu’s work include Land Use and Ecosystem Services (14 papers), Urban Green Space and Health (12 papers) and Spondyloarthritis Studies and Treatments (7 papers). Hongxiao Liu is often cited by papers focused on Land Use and Ecosystem Services (14 papers), Urban Green Space and Health (12 papers) and Spondyloarthritis Studies and Treatments (7 papers). Hongxiao Liu collaborates with scholars based in China, United States and Germany. Hongxiao Liu's co-authors include Hai Ren, Feng Li, Rusong Wang, Baolong Han, Zhongzhi Zhang, Huifu Nong, Yuyang Zhang, Qinfeng Guo, Bin Wu and Hongfang Lü and has published in prestigious journals such as The Journal of Chemical Physics, Cell Metabolism and Journal of Power Sources.
